Output 3bbf29c34fac66123c1e41ed8d44f0c30e40349a4ba5c4a269882e3be78583aa:1

value
1955437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 892e8385c49dab7bd247600ab3914b12dad8417e OP_EQUAL
address
3ECNDf58RAafebJZT8543pr65NipzYwyC7
transaction
3bbf29c34fac66123c1e41ed8d44f0c30e40349a4ba5c4a269882e3be78583aa
spent
true